Banning a duper's IP is a logical thing to do , but most dupers are using dial-up and a dynamic IP (meaning changes each re-log-on). As you may see , banning someone like that is nearly impossible. My suggestion is contact Jerry @ coastgames.com for a closed server. He had wantted to offer this service to sysops but had little responce. I use this at Vid's World , it does help but you will still get (inexperianced players) players with little experiance and think they need that advantage. And one more thing .. d/l from my website Eq's dupe catcher , it reads the logs and pulls all the IP's for you so you can determin dupers from that and ingame passwords. Otherwise there is not much to stop them (dupers) built into TWGS cept the single IP setting. Hope this has been of help. Vid Kid/CareTaker |

It's normally fairly easy to ban a player even if they have a dynamic IP. Most only vary in the last set of digits. |
